Symptoms should last for at least 2 months from when someone first falls ill for it … Webb28 feb. 2024 · The pneumonia that COVID-19 causes tends to take hold in both lungs. Air sacs in the lungs fill with fluid, limiting their ability to take in oxygen and causing shortness of breath, cough and other symptoms. While most people recover from pneumonia without any lasting lung damage, the pneumonia associated with COVID-19 can be severe.

WebbCase fatality rate (CFR) In the media, it is often the “case fatality rate” that is talked about when the risk of death from COVID-19 is discussed. 1. This measure is sometimes also called case fatality risk or case fatality ratio. It is often abbreviated as CFR. The CFR is not the same as the risk of death for an infected person – even ... May 7, 2003 (CIDRAP News) – The World Health Organization (WHO) today estimated the overall fatality rate for SARS (severe acute respiratory syndrome) patients at 14% to 15%, significantly higher than previous estimates. The agency estimated the rate for people older than 64 years to be more than 50%. The revised WHO estimates, …

Webb8 okt. 2024 · Symptoms. SARS usually begins with flu-like signs and symptoms — fever, chills, muscle aches, headache and occasionally diarrhea. After about a week, signs and symptoms include: Fever of 100.5 F (38 C) or higher; Dry cough; Shortness of breath; When to see a doctor. SARS is a serious illness that can lead to death.
